Technical Field

[0001] This application relates to the field of cylinder head cover technology, specifically a cylinder head cover with an integrated camshaft bearing cover. Background Technology

[0002] The cylinder head cover is a cover that covers the engine block, preventing external impurities from entering the engine and providing a seal. Existing cylinder head assemblies consist of the cylinder head and the cylinder head cover. The camshaft is mounted on the cylinder head, and its axial position is fixed by a camshaft bearing cap. The cylinder head cover is mounted on the top surface of the cylinder head, sealing the camshaft chamber with a cylinder head cover gasket.

[0003] The shortcomings of the existing cylinder head cover are as follows: First, the camshaft bearing cover is a split type, that is, there is one intake camshaft bearing cover and one exhaust camshaft bearing cover for each combustion chamber, and there is also a front camshaft bearing cover at the front end of the cylinder head. The cylinder head cover is then installed on the cylinder head for sealing, resulting in a large number of parts and high overall cost. Second, the overall rigidity of the cylinder head assembly is insufficient, which affects the engine's NVH performance. Utility Model Content

[0004] To address the shortcomings of existing technologies, this application provides a cylinder head cover with an integrated camshaft bearing cover, which has the advantage of improving the performance of the cylinder head cover and solves the problem of complex overall structure and insufficient rigidity of the cylinder head cover.

[0005] To achieve the above objectives, this application provides the following technical solution: a cylinder head cover with an integrated camshaft bearing cover, comprising a cylinder head body and a cylinder head cover body, wherein the cylinder head cover body is mounted on the top of the cylinder head body, and a front camshaft bearing cover, an intake camshaft bearing cover, and an exhaust camshaft bearing cover are disposed on the inner side of the cylinder head cover body, with two sets of the front camshaft bearing covers located symmetrically on the inner side of the cylinder head cover body, and several sets of the intake camshaft bearing covers and exhaust camshaft bearing covers located linearly distributed on the inner side of the cylinder head body.

[0006] The improved cylinder head cover design adopts an integrated camshaft bearing cover solution, which is simple and compact in structure, easy to install, reduces the overall weight, lowers costs, and shortens the development cycle. It also facilitates the layout of the vehicle's engine compartment.

[0007] Preferably, the cylinder head body and the cylinder head cover body are sealed with an adhesive.

[0016] Please see Figure 1-2 A cylinder head cover with integrated camshaft bearing caps includes a cylinder head body 1 and a cylinder head cover body 2. The cylinder head cover body 2 is installed on the top of the cylinder head body 1. The cylinder head body 1 and the cylinder head cover body 2 are sealed with a glue. A front camshaft bearing cap 3, an intake camshaft bearing cap 4, and an exhaust camshaft bearing cap 5 are provided on the inner side of the cylinder head cover body 2. Two sets of front camshaft bearing caps 3 are located symmetrically on the inner side of the cylinder head cover body 2. Several sets of intake camshaft bearing caps 4 and exhaust camshaft bearing caps 5 are linearly distributed on the inner side of the cylinder head body 1.

[0017] In use, the front camshaft bearing cover 3, intake camshaft bearing cover 4, and exhaust camshaft bearing cover 5 are assembled inside the cylinder head cover body 2. The cylinder head cover body 2 is sealed to the top of the cylinder head body 1 with a rubber sealant. The cylinder head cover adopts an integrated camshaft bearing cover solution, which has a simple and compact structure. It can reduce the number of parts in the engine, such as the front camshaft bearing cover 3, intake camshaft bearing cover 4, exhaust camshaft bearing cover 5, and cylinder head cover gasket, thereby reducing the overall weight, lowering the cost, and shortening the development cycle. This is beneficial for the layout of the engine compartment and improves the engine's NVH performance.
